Belavia cancels flights to 8 countries

Belavia, national carrier of Belarus, has cancelled flights to 8 countries after EU banned Belarusian airlines from the airspace and airports of the member states.


Belavia said it has cancelled flighst to Warsaw, Milan, Amsterdam, Rome, Frankfurt, Berlin, Munich, Hannover, Vienna, Brussels, Barcelona and Kaliningrad through October 30.


Carrier also canceled the flights to Tallinn from 28 May to 28 August 2021 for the same reason.


Last Sunday A Ryanair plane that took off from Athens to Vilnius was diverted by Belarusian authorities to the airport in Minsk, the capital of Belarus. Journalist Roman Protasevich, former editor of the Nexta group opposed to the Belarusian administration, was detained before the plane was allowed to continue its flight.


After the incident EU banned Belarusian airlines from the airspace and airports of the member states.
